01 / Profile

An independent operator.

Guillaume Kevin Jenner is a self-made entrepreneur and private investor with active operations across France, Hong Kong, Singapore and the United Arab Emirates.

Over years of independent activity, he has founded and scaled multiple companies in technology, B2B services and the blockchain sector, while developing an international portfolio of venture investments and real estate holdings.

His approach is grounded in disciplined analysis, a long-term strategic perspective, and an uncompromising commitment to ethical conduct and corporate governance.

02 / Background

Built without a blueprint.

Guillaume's career began without the benefit of formal higher education. He built his foundation through self-instruction, applied practice, and disciplined capital management.

In an earlier chapter of his career, professional poker provided both a rigorous training in probabilistic thinking and the initial capital that funded his first business and investment activities. He withdrew from the professional circuit several years ago to focus exclusively on entrepreneurship and investment; the analytical discipline acquired during that period continues to inform his work today.

What followed was a decade of operating: building, scaling, divesting and reinvesting. Each chapter has reinforced a single conviction — that durable value is created at the intersection of patience, conviction and rigorous execution.

03 / Areas of activity

Where he operates.

A. Founder

Entrepreneurship

Founder and operator of multiple companies in blockchain, information technology and B2B services. Active oversight of strategy, governance and risk across a portfolio of operating businesses, with prior ventures in marketing technology, search optimisation and IT support.

B. Investor

Venture capital

Direct seed and Series A investments in technology ventures, alongside selective venture-capital exposure. Long-standing presence in digital-asset and blockchain ecosystems, with a focus on infrastructure and institutional-grade projects. Investments are held through structured vehicles in compliance with applicable regulatory frameworks.

C. Property

Real estate

A complementary asset class within the broader portfolio. Selective acquisitions of prime real estate across the jurisdictions of activity, held through dedicated structures and managed with the same long-term perspective applied to operating businesses and venture investments.

D. Reach

International footprint

Operations distributed across France, Hong Kong, Singapore and the United Arab Emirates, reflecting both portfolio diversification and proximity to leading global financial and technology centres.
